def to_Table(df: pd.DataFrame):
    """Displays a Pandas DataFrame as a rich table."""
    table = Table(show_header=True, header_style="bold magenta")
    
    for col in df.columns:
        table.add_column(col)
    
    for _, row in df.iterrows():
        table.add_row(*row.astype(str).tolist())
    
    # console.print(table)
    return table
